Nous utilisons un fournisseur de services tiers pour envoyer des e-mails transactionnels. J'ai récemment remarqué une augmentation des taux d'échec pour un domaine de réception donné.
Les envois échouent avec l'erreur "498 No MX for example.com".
Les envois sont réessayés après un délai donné, puis réussissent généralement après quelques tentatives. Mais parfois, ils dépassent la limite de nouvelle tentative et sont supprimés définitivement.
J'ai contacté le support du fournisseur et ils m'ont dit que cela était dû au fait que le domaine de réception déclarait MX de différents fournisseurs.
$ dig mx example.com
;; ANSWER SECTION:
example.com. 859 IN MX 25 mail05.example.com.
example.com. 859 IN MX 20 mail11.example.net.
Ils font référence au fait qu'un MX utilise example.com
et que l'autre utilise example.net
et c'est apparemment une mauvaise pratique et peut conduire à l'erreur décrite ci-dessus.
C'est la première fois que j'entends quelque chose comme ça et j'appellerais instantanément BS dessus, mais je pensais leur donner le bénéfice du doute et entendre ce que les autres ont à dire sur le sujet.
example.com.
utilise un fournisseur de messagerie tiers, tel que G Suite, afin qu'ils aient un enregistrement MX de aspmx.l.google.com.
.